#b57009 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b57009 is composed of 71% red, 43.9%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38.1% magenta, 95%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 35.9 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 37.3%. #b57009 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e012 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#b57009 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b57009 has RGB values of R:181, G:112,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.95,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11890697.

Shades and Tints of #b57009
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0801 is the darkest color, while #fffc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b57009
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#656059 is the less saturated color, while #bc7102 is the most saturated one.
